The Brethren Moons are one creepy concept. I've always liked the idea of sentient astronomical objects quite a bit, just this massive thing that is harboring a huge secret. LOCAL58 pulled off this type of thing really well. In addition to looking terrifying, what with their writhing tentacles and maw at the center of their mass, but the sounds they emit are pure nightmare fuel, bone-chilling squishing and ear-piercing squeals just produces such a scowl-inducing effect in me. It's something you want to stay just extremely far away from. You know, it's a shame these things only appear in Dead Space 3 (besides technically being background antagonists in the first two) which relegates to them to obscurity, as I believe these moons have a ton of potential in crafting further intriguing horror scenarios. Discovering they were behind the Markers was a huge deal and Dead Space 3 DLC ends on a cliffhanger, so unfortunately we may never know what becomes of these gigantic, hulking behemoths due to Dead Space basically being a dead-in-the-water series at this point...
